:rotfl: I have a dillema !!! my rear brake make a agonizing squeek whenever the wheel turns without the brake applied ! I've changed shoe's , return springs , chamfered , filed , shimed , lubricated and just about every thing else tou can think off ... It all started when I changed out the origanal brake shoes . obnoxis enough to break concentration ! Any ideas ???????

Glenn ;)

i once had a problem many years ago i cannot remmember what bike it was,but same thing as yours,it was the springs rubbing on hub the springs could go either way round.so i put them the other way round all good after that.

  • Author

:) Squeek gone !!!!!!! the after market springs I had used on the last shoe swap were about 1 mm larger OD than the stock springs ! EBC shoes w/ stock springs and all is quiet and stops as good as drums will !!!!

Hi Lee , Yes it's one of Chris's OKO's , Got a swingarm shaft too for the next full teardown ... Carb worked great the bit I got to try it , mine leaked fuel out the bowl vent from the start . And after playing with the float level for the 4th or 5th time , in my haste I didn't have the bowl seated square on the body and cracked it snugging up the screws ! my own fault :rotfl: ... After putting the delorto back on and bringing the OKO in the house to inspect properly with a magnifying glass , I found a tiny nick in the tip of the needle !!! No ones fault but my own for not inspecting it closer when I first took it apart to adjust ! BUT I did ride the old girl (wilst turning gas on & off ) and I can say the carb swap is well worth the effort ! When the float level would approach were it should be , LOTS more response and Felt Quite abit more OOMPH down way low ! I can't wait to get the fuel level issue fixed and get it back on the bike .... And from what I felt his jetting is on the money , he ships w/needle in the middle clip position and up or down with that should be enough for any needed minor tweaking ... His airboot (aircleaner side) is SWEET , but I would recomend having a new intake rubber as you have to massage the carb on and fresh soft pliable rubber makes it a non issue ! but a old stiff one may crack ....
